On 19 December 1967, Newport News exchanged fire with 20–28 separate shore batteries, simultaneously, off the coast of North Vietnam. During the short period of this engagement, over 300 enemy rounds bracketed the cruiser's position, but she suffered no direct hits. This encounter led American forward observers to nickname Newport News "The Gray Ghost from the East Coast," a moniker she retained throughout her three Vietnam deployments.

>BuOrd was particularly - and justifiably - proud of this design. The high ROF figure was routinely and reliably achieved by all three ships of this class. Commented BuShips engineer E.A. Wright after viewing a demonstration bombardment by USS Newport News on 07 September 1949: "The automatic ammunition supply and loading worked perfectly and at the designed rate, which still seems to me phenomenal for that caliber."

Building a ship to win the very same sort of battle that saw the Solomons devour cruisers at an alarming rate, since the fast-firing CLs didn't have the range to hammer Japanese ships before they fired their Type 93s, and the CAs couldn't fire rapidly enough to hit the violently-maneuvering ships. "Well, fuck, we'll just build a CA that fires as fast as the CLs can!" (BuOrd also developed a less-successful autoloader for the 6"/47... it was intended to let CLs use their main batteries for air defense and hopefully hit German bombers before they released their Fritz-X's.)

Yes, I know, that sort of battle had ended by mid-1943 and gun cruisers were largely obsolete for surface warfare after that. Remember the proud military tradition of always preparing for the LAST war you fought...
